Pothunaidupeta Population - Srikakulam, Andhra Pradesh

Pothunaidupeta is a medium size village located in Santhabommali Mandal of Srikakulam district, Andhra Pradesh with total 455 families residing. The Pothunaidupeta village has population of 1707 of which 829 are males while 878 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Pothunaidupeta village population of children with age 0-6 is 185 which makes up 10.84 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Pothunaidupeta village is 1059 which is higher than Andhra Pradesh state average of 993. Child Sex Ratio for the Pothunaidupeta as per census is 1256, higher than Andhra Pradesh average of 939.

Pothunaidupeta village has lower literacy rate compared to Andhra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Pothunaidupeta village was 59.59 % compared to 67.02 % of Andhra Pradesh. In Pothunaidupeta Male literacy stands at 68.81 % while female literacy rate was 50.71 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 0.23 % of total population in Pothunaidupeta village. The village Pothunaidupeta currently doesn’t have any Schedule Tribe (ST) population.

Work Profile

In Pothunaidupeta village out of total population, 899 were engaged in work activities. 28.36 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 71.64 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 899 workers engaged in Main Work, 94 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 135 were Agricultural labourer.
